Instant Tax Service

Instant Tax Service

Accountants & Bookkeeping in St. Louis, MO

Accountants & Bookkeeping Taxes

Contact us

Location

1304 S Florissant Rd,
St. Louis , MO 63121 UNITED STATES

Reviews

Instant Tax Service 314-524-9700
1304 S Florissant Rd,
St. Louis , MO 63121 UNITED STATES
$
Instant Tax Service

Detail information

Company name
Instant Tax Service
Category
Accountants & Bookkeeping
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Instant Tax Service

Contacts Location Details